Financial Lines underwriters work with lines of business such as Directors and Officers Liability, Employment Practices Liability, Crime and Fiduciary, Errors & Omissions, Management/Professional Liability, and Cyber. We offer an opportunity for you to work with other underwriting, risk control and claim consultants to meet the evolving insurance needs of our clients. CNA’s underwriters are responsible for selecting and pricing risks that have profit potential. The process requires underwriters to evaluate a business by reviewing industry, business and government data and then deciding whether to accept or decline the risk. The underwriter is also responsible for pricing, as well as maintaining a steady flow of new and renewal business.
